# 适配导航栏高度的Swift编程指南
在iOS开发中,导航栏是我们经常会用到的控件之一。然而,由于不同设备的屏幕尺寸和分辨率的差异,导航栏的高度也会有所不同。因此,在开发过程中,我们需要对导航栏的高度进行适配,以保证用户在不同设备上都能有良好的体验。
下面我们就来介绍如何在Swift中适配导航栏高度,并给出代码示例。
## 适配导航栏高度
在Swift中,我们可以通过获取导航栏的高度来进
一、导航的定义 导航作为网站或者平台的骨架,是产品设计中不容忽视的一环导航是内容或者功能的定位、导向与通道。二、导航分类 遵循导航层级结构,包括全局导航和局部导航 全局导航往往指页眉和页脚,存在于网站的大部分页面,便于用户随时跳转 局部导航是是更深层级的导航,不作用于全局,存在于特定的功能区,可分布在页面各部分三、常见导航1.顶部导航-标签式说明:导航水平分布;导航区域固定;标签平铺展示,点击进入
转载
2023-08-23 18:48:26
119阅读
# Swift 导航栏适配教程
## 1. 导航栏适配流程
首先,让我们了解一下实现导航栏适配的流程。下面的表格展示了具体的步骤:
| 步骤 | 描述 |
| ----- | -------------------------------------------------- |
| 步骤1 | 创
# iOS 导航栏高度适配指南
在 iOS 开发中,适配不同设备和屏幕的导航栏高度是一个非常重要的任务。以下是一个完整的指南,帮助你实现 iOS 导航栏高度的适配。
## 流程概述
在开始之前,让我们先看一下整个流程的步骤。如下表所示:
| 步骤 | 描述 |
| ---- | ----------------------
我们都知道,现在写出导航栏的方式有很多,而今天我给大家带来最简单的且最主要写出导航栏的方法,也就是用css来写出。用css来写的话主要分为垂直导航栏和水平导航栏,当然其中也有很多“衍生品”,但是大多数都是将导航栏写的更好看,更精致美观,或者是功能更加齐全但是 在这里我来给大家浅谈一下,可以让新手小白更直观的了解用css来写出导航栏方法,所以这里介绍的相对基础,也更容易理解了 垂直导航栏:首先我们得
导航栏布局每次涉及到导航栏布局就很难受,总感觉很模糊。UINavigationController 构成UIBarItem : NSObjectUIBarItem 类是一个可以放置在 Bar 之上的所有小控件类的抽象类。UIBarButtonItem : UIBarItem类似 UIButton 。放在 UINavigationBar 或者 UIToolbar 上。重点属性: customView
喔…这标题,吓我一跳;请稍等…思绪整理中…Android中, 经常被这些高度绊脚. 完全进入懵逼的状态, 有木有?请允许我,介绍清楚!通常情况下, 宽度都是很友好的,但是高度就呵呵, 所以本文只介绍高度的计算.2018-10-17更新安卓开发过程中, 经常被状态栏的高度 导航栏的高度 键盘的高度 搞的稀里糊涂. 经过一段时间整理, 似乎找到了比以前更有效的方法,如下:所有操作只针对Activity
# 实现获取Android状态栏高度和导航栏高度
## 介绍
作为一名经验丰富的开发者,如何获取Android设备的状态栏高度和导航栏高度是一个基础且常见的问题。在这篇文章中,我将向你展示如何实现这一功能。
## 总体流程
首先,让我们来看一下获取Android状态栏高度和导航栏高度的整体流程:
| 步骤 | 操作 |
|-----|-----|
| 1 | 获取状态栏高度 |
| 2 |
## Android 导航栏高度的实现
作为一名经验丰富的开发者,我将教会你如何实现 Android 导航栏高度。下面是整个流程的步骤表格:
步骤 | 描述
---|---
1 | 获取屏幕高度
2 | 获取应用区域高度
3 | 计算导航栏高度
接下来,我将一步一步告诉你每个步骤需要做什么,并提供相应的代码。
### 步骤1:获取屏幕高度
为了获得导航栏的高度,我们首先需要获取屏幕的高度
# 安卓导航栏高度解析
Android应用开发中,用户界面的设计是至关重要的一环,尤其是导航栏(Navigation Bar)。导航栏是应用中用户交互的一个重要组成部分,它为用户提供了便捷的导航选项。在本文中,我们将深入解析Android导航栏的高度,如何获取和设置导航栏高度,并通过具体的代码示例帮助开发者更好地理解这一概念。
## 导航栏的概念
导航栏通常位于屏幕的底部,用于提供应用的主要
# 适配iOS iPhone14 导航栏代码示例
在开发iOS应用程序时,导航栏是一个非常重要的组件,它负责展示应用程序的层次结构,方便用户进行页面之间的切换和导航。而随着iPhone14的推出,我们需要确保我们的应用程序的导航栏能够适配新的设备并保持良好的用户体验。
在本文中,我们将介绍如何使用Swift语言来适配iOS iPhone14的导航栏,并提供一些代码示例供参考。
## 导航栏适
主要功能几行代码轻松实现底部导航栏(Tab文字图片高度随意更改);中间可添加加号按钮,也可添加文字;(足够的属性满足你需要实现的加号样式)如果还不能满足、中间可添加自定义View;Tab中随意添加小红点提示、数字消息提示;点击按钮可跳转界面、也可作为Tab切换Fragment;2.0.+迁移AndroidX、支持ViewPager2;剥离导航栏、不传Fragment则不会创建ViewPager、可
前言最近在iPhone 12 系列机型上开发项目时,发现使用项目提供的获取状态栏、导航栏高度方法获取到的高度是错误的,随后跟踪排查最终解决这个问题,所以自己想简单的总结一下问题原因和解决办法。本文主要介绍问题原因和解决办法,最终提供一个能准确获取iPhone 状态栏、导航栏、TabBar高度的方法。问题原因出现问题的原因是,我们大多开发在使用获取状态栏、导航栏高度方法都是以下方法来获取的:// 状
转载
2023-07-13 09:58:02
482阅读
# 实现 Swift 底部导航栏
## 介绍
在 Swift 中,底部导航栏是一个常见的界面元素,可以帮助用户快速切换页面。本文将教会你如何在 Swift 中实现底部导航栏。首先,我们来看一下整个实现过程的流程图。
```mermaid
gantt
title 实现底部导航栏流程
dateFormat YYYY-MM-DD
section 需求分析
需求收集与
# Swift导航栏按钮
在iOS开发中,导航栏按钮是用户界面中常见的元素之一,用于触发特定操作或切换视图。在Swift中,我们可以很容易地添加自定义的导航栏按钮来增强用户体验。
## 添加导航栏按钮
要在导航栏中添加按钮,我们可以使用`navigationItem`属性来访问导航栏的相关属性。下面是一个简单的例子,展示如何在导航栏右侧添加一个自定义按钮:
```swift
overrid
## 实现swift导航栏渐变的步骤
为了实现swift导航栏的渐变效果,我们需要按照以下步骤进行操作:
| 步骤 | 操作 |
| --- | --- |
| 1 | 创建一个自定义导航栏 |
| 2 | 添加渐变效果 |
| 3 | 设置导航栏的颜色 |
| 4 | 设置导航栏的透明度 |
接下来,我们将一步一步地进行操作,并给出相应的代码示例和注释说明。
### 1. 创建一个自定义
# 实现 Swift 导航栏渐变效果
## 介绍
作为一名经验丰富的开发者,我将向你展示如何实现在 Swift 中实现导航栏渐变效果。这将帮助你更好地理解导航栏的定制和UI效果的实现。
## 步骤
| 步骤 | 操作 |
| ------ | ----------- |
| 1 | 创建一个新的 Swift 项目 |
| 2 | 在 ViewController.swift 中添加以下代码
# Android 隐藏导航栏高度的实现指南
在Android开发中,隐藏导航栏是一项常见的需求,尤其是在全屏应用中。今天,我们将逐步介绍如何实现这一目标,帮助你了解整个流程及每一个步骤中的具体实现代码。
## 整体流程
为了实现隐藏导航栏的功能,我们可以将整个过程分为以下几个步骤:
| 步骤 | 描述 | 代码
# Android 取导航栏高度的实现方法
作为一名经验丰富的开发者,我很高兴能帮助刚入行的小白们解决实际问题。今天,我们将一起学习如何在Android应用中获取导航栏的高度。这个过程虽然简单,但对于初学者来说,了解其原理和实现步骤是非常有帮助的。
## 步骤概览
首先,我们通过一个表格来了解整个实现流程: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 检查设备
## Android获取导航栏高度的实现方法
### 1. 引言
在开发Android应用时,有时需要获取导航栏的高度,以便进行相应的布局适配或其他操作。本文将介绍如何通过编程的方式获取Android设备导航栏的高度。
### 2. 流程图
```mermaid
flowchart TD
A(开始)
B[获取根布局]
C[获取导航栏高度]
D(结束)